The name Mildred has its origins in Old English, derived from the elements "milde," meaning "gentle" or "mild," and "þryð," meaning "strength" or "power." It first appeared in England during the early medieval period and is historically associated with Saint Mildred, a 7th-century abbess of Minster in Kent, which contributed to its popularity in Anglo-Saxon England. The name embodies the qualities of gentleness combined with strength, reflecting the characteristics of those who bore it, often seen as nurturing yet resilient figures. Variations of Mildred can be found in different cultures, such as "Mildred" in English, "Mildrith" in Old English, and "Mildreda" in some historical texts. In modern times, the name has seen a decline in popularity but remains a classic choice, often evoking a sense of vintage charm.
